Data and scripts from: Replacement drives native β-diversity of British avifauna, while richness differences shape alien β-diversity

Aim: We explored the range shifts of alien and native birds, the responses
of alien and native β-diversity to abiotic factors, and the effect of
native diversity on alien β-diversity in two time periods. Location: Great
Britain. Time period: 1968–1972, 2007–2011. Taxa studied: Breeding birds.
Methods: We estimated range shifts of alien and native species between the
periods 1968–1972 and 2007–2011. Following, β-diversity of alien and
native communities was estimated by Jaccard pairwise index (βtot) and
partitioned into richness difference and replacement component for each
period. We built abiotic Generalized Dissimilarity Models including
abiotic factors for alien and native βtot and their components and a
biotic model for aliens including native taxonomic and functional
diversity as predictors. Results: Most alien and half native species
expanded into new regions during the 40-year period. The native species
range shifts did not exhibit a clear pattern along the longitudinal or
latitudinal gradient, while alien species tended to move north-westwards.
The richness difference was the dominant component of alien β-diversity,
and the replacement component contributed mostly to native β-diversity.
Alien β-diversity responded similarly, but less strongly than native
β-diversity, to the abiotic gradients. Temperature-related variables,
distance, and precipitation were the most important abiotic drivers of
native and alien β-diversity. The biotic model of alien β-diversity
explained more deviance than the abiotic model. Main conclusions: Alien
species expanded into new regions over the 40 years, with alien
β-diversity driven mostly by species gains. The effect of environmental
filtering on alien communities was weaker compared to native communities
but was slightly reinforced in the second period compared to the first
period, highlighting the role of environmental change in shaping diversity
patterns. Native diversity played a key role in driving alien β-diversity,
through biotic interactions or/and by reflecting climatic suitability or
niche availability for aliens.
